Demotion for the prosecutor who pursued the Sinan Ateş murder case: Critical appointments at the HSK
The Council of Judges and Prosecutors (HSK) has announced new appointments and reassignments. Accordingly, the prosecutor who solved the Sinan Ateş murder case has been appointed as a 'regional prosecutor'.

The HSK has announced its 2024 main decree for judicial and administrative judiciary. Requests for reassignment from 4 thousand 9 judges and prosecutors in the judicial branch have been finalized.
In the HSK's judicial decree, Durdu Özer, the Deputy Chief Public Prosecutor of Ankara who was removed from his post while conducting the investigation into the murder of former Ülkü Ocakları President Sinan Ateş, was appointed to the Ankara Regional Court of Justice as a 'regional prosecutor'.
Journalist Alican Uludağ shared the following regarding the removal on his social media account:
"The insider information turned out to be true. Deputy Chief Public Prosecutor Durdu Özer, who was removed from his post for pursuing the Sinan Ateş murder case, has now been removed from the Ankara Courthouse."
PROSECUTOR DURMUŞ ALİ KAYA, REMOVED FROM THE SINAN ATEŞ FILE, APPOINTED TO DIYARBAKIR
In another post, Alican Uludağ reported that Durmuş Ali Kaya, another prosecutor removed from the file alongside Deputy Chief Public Prosecutor Durdu Özer, who was removed for pursuing the Sinan Ateş murder case, has been appointed from Ankara to the Çınar Prosecutor's Office in Diyarbakır.
DEMOTION FOR TABUR, WHO DISPLAYED HIS ARSENAL
Oktay Tabur, who displayed his arsenal, was demoted and appointed as a judge in Karşıyaka.
Oktay Tabur, who made headlines with photos showing him displaying his arsenal in the 'rest room' at the İzmir Courthouse, was demoted from his position as President of the İzmir Heavy Penal Court to a judgeship in Karşıyaka.
HSK HAD LAUNCHED AN INVESTIGATION; SILIFKE CHIEF PUBLIC PROSECUTOR ESKİLER APPOINTED TO AKSARAY
Silifke Chief Public Prosecutor Selman Eskiler, who made headlines with photos of him alongside Alihan Kuriş, the leader of the Süleymancılar community, was appointed as a public prosecutor in Aksaray.
Eskiler's photo had become a topic of discussion on social media, leading the HSK to launch an investigation.
MEMBERS OF THE PANEL THAT SIGNED THE REASONED DECISION IN THE ÇORLU CASE REASSIGNED
The members of the court who signed the reasoned decision in the Çorlu train accident case were also reassigned. Prosecutor Bahtiyar Gövce from the Çorlu 1st Heavy Penal Court was appointed to the Küçükçekmece Chief Public Prosecutor's Office. Judges Halil Özbilen and Ülkü Özbilen were appointed as judges in Uzunköprü, Edirne.
DEMOTION FOR THE CHIEF PROSECUTOR WHO FORCIBLY REMOVED A LAWYER FROM A RESTROOM
Kaş Chief Public Prosecutor Gökhan Feyzoğlu, who made headlines after having lawyer Hakan Tüzen forcibly removed from a restroom by security police at the Kaş Courthouse in Antalya, was demoted and sent to Afyonkarahisar. Antalya Bar Association lawyer Polat Balkan shared the incident report and said, "This is an open call to the Minister of Justice: Read this report and assign a gold-plated toilet to the Antalya Kaş Chief Public Prosecutor!"
Mustafa Duran, President of the Karabük Heavy Penal Court, who oversaw the case of the Gabonese student Dina, who was found dead in the Filyos Stream in Karabük, was appointed as President of the Düzce Heavy Penal Court.
NOTABLE APPOINTMENTS FROM THE KOBANI, ABDULLAH ZEYDAN, AND HAKKARI MAYOR CASES
Barış Karakurt, one of the members of the Ankara 22nd Heavy Penal Court that oversaw the Kobani case, in which former HDP Co-Chair Selahattin Demirtaş was sentenced to 42 years in prison, was appointed as a member of the Diyarbakır Regional Court of Justice.
Erhan Çavuşoğlu, a court member who signed the revocation of the finalized ban on rights, which led to the non-issuance of the certificate of election to Abdullah Zeydan, who was elected Mayor of Van Metropolitan Municipality, was appointed as President of the Diyarbakır 5th Heavy Penal Court. The HSK had launched an investigation into the Diyarbakır 5th Heavy Penal Court, which issued the decision to restore Abdullah Zeydan's banned rights.
Birtan Şeker, President of the Hakkari 1st Heavy Penal Court, where Hakkari Mayor Mehmet Sıddık Akış, who was replaced by a trustee, was sentenced to 19 years and 6 months in prison, was appointed to Zonguldak.
DEMOTION FOR CHIEF PROSECUTORS OF 7 CITIES
Erzurum Chief Public Prosecutor Hüseyin Tuncel, Kırıkkale Chief Public Prosecutor İbrahim Keskin, Uşak Chief Public Prosecutor Serdar Durmuş, Kırşehir Chief Public Prosecutor Soner Aygün, Karabük Chief Public Prosecutor Koray Kesgin, Kırklareli Chief Public Prosecutor Hazım Aslancı, and Bolu Chief Public Prosecutor Ali Keleş were demoted and appointed as prosecutors at the Court of Cassation.
THE JUDGE INSULTED BY THE MHP MP WAS ALSO REASSIGNED
The place of duty of Ramazan Kaya, the Pınarbaşı Judge and District Election Board President who was insulted by MHP Kayseri MP Baki Ersoy during the March 31 elections, was also changed.
According to the 2024 Main Decree for Judicial and Administrative Judiciary, Ramazan Kaya was made a judge in Bozüyük.
In the March 31 local elections, CHP candidate Deniz Yağan won the election in Pınarbaşı, Kayseri, the hometown of Alparslan Türkeş, with 33.30 percent of the vote. MHP candidate Menduh Uzunluoğlu, who remained at 31.18 percent, objected to the result. Subsequently, it was decided to renew the elections.
CHP's Oğuz Kaan Salıcı had shared footage of MHP Kayseri MP Baki Ersoy on his social media account.
In the footage shared by Salıcı, who wrote "I am sharing it uncensored" on his post, the moments when MHP MP Ersoy used profanity after telling the judge "I am an MP" on election night caused a major backlash.
STATEMENT FROM THE HSK
The statement from the HSK included the following:
The work regarding the 2024 Main Decrees for Judicial and Administrative Judiciary by the First Chamber of the Council of Judges and Prosecutors was completed and finalized as of June 13, 2024.
Colleagues who wish to request a re-examination of their appointments made by the decree must submit their requests via the UYAP personnel screen by filling out the explanation section under the title "Judge/Prosecutor Appointment Request Form" no later than the end of the workday on Monday, June 24, 2024, without waiting for notification, in order to ensure their status is finalized as soon as possible.
Our colleagues do not need to send physical petitions. (Those who are not at their duty station must send them via UYAP through the courthouses in their current locations.)
After our colleagues' re-examination requests reach the Decree Bureau, information regarding the receipt of the appointment request forms will be sent to the relevant parties via message to the phone numbers they provided in the form within 24 hours (or the first following workday if it falls on a weekend or public holiday).
Our colleagues who were not appointed by the decree do not have the right to request a re-examination.
The announcement regarding the receipt of our colleagues' requests for permanent authority will be made separately after the re-examination requests of the decree are concluded.
It is planned that the appointment notifications for our colleagues will be sent starting from Monday, July 1, 2024.
